Before we begin, we would like to announce that Input has been renamed to Mergin Maps as of May 2022.
After a long wait and weeks of development, we finally managed to release Mergin Maps on iOSlatform.
Update: Mergin Maps app is now available through Apple App Store:
We are pleased to announce the Beta release of Mergin Maps on iOS TestFlight. To install the app, simply click on this link from your iOS device: https://testflight.apple.com/join/JO5EIywn. This will open a window to first install TestFlight app. After that, you should be able to install Mergin Maps on your device.
Mergin Maps is the first QGIS based app to be released for iOS. Using Mergin Maps , you can open, view and edit your QGIS projects and data on your iPhone/iPad.
For setting QGIS projects, transferring data/projects and capturing data, you can see the documentation here.
In addition to the great works of the QGIS community in the past to port QGIS to Android devices, we had to do major changes to be able to have Mergin Maps on iOS. Below are the steps we had taken in the past couple of years, to pave the way:
As a first step, we decided to create a new library in QGIS based on Qt Quick for QGIS. This allowed us to easily create platform independent apps for touch devices.
The library has been built on components ported from QField project. In addition, we have been improving the library and added support for new types of edit form widgets. Details of the QGIS Enhancement Proposal for QGIS Quick can be found here.
By providing static data providers, it was possible to compile code of data providers directly into qgis_core library. This was a major step, as iOS does not support dynamic libraries. Details of this QGIS enhancement can be found here.
We will be delighted to hear your suggestions and feedback, mainly critical ones so that we can improve the application and user experience. After ironing out any issues reported during the Beta testing in the TestFlight, we will publish the app to the App Store.
Let's make the QGIS work for you
Lutra Consulting is a QGIS-focused boutique providing QGIS and custom plugin development, consulting, training and support services.